2 Ways to Reach Shivpuri to Saharanpur by train and bus

Planning a trip from Shivpuri to Saharanpur Cleartrip helps you select the best route between Shivpuri & Saharanpur based on price, timing & easy mode of transport. Prices are indicative (one-way, one traveller).
Tip: Select a departure date for more accurate pricing.

Distance between Shivpuri & Saharanpur

The distance from Shivpuri to Saharanpur is approximately 604 kms. Take a look at the 2 routes available to reach Saharanpur from Shivpuri

  • 1.

  • Reach Shivpuri to Saharanpur by train

  • 15 h 30 m

  • Rs. 336

 
Shivpuri
 
15 h 30 m
Rs. 336
You can reach Saharanpur from Shivpuri by travelling in a train. Shivpuri to Saharanpur train takes approximately 15 h 30 m. You can catch a train from Shivpuri and get down at Saharanpur. The price of the train ticket is approximately Rs. 336.
 
Saharanpur
  • 2.

  • Reach Shivpuri to Saharanpur by train and bus

  • 12 h 4 m

  • Rs. 1320

 
Shivpuri
 
4 h 10 m
Rs. 663

Step 1: Take a Train from Shivpuri to reach Agra

You can reach Agra from Shivpuri by travelling in a train. Shivpuri to Agra train takes approximately 4 h 10 m. You can catch a train from Shivpuri and get down at Agra. The price of the train ticket is approximately Rs. 663.
 
Agra
 
7 h 54 m
Rs. 657

Step 2: Take a Bus from Agra to reach Saharanpur

Travelling in a bus is one of the ways to reach Saharanpur from Agra. The total journey between Agra & Saharanpur takes around 7 h 54 m in a bus. The bus ticket price for the journey is approximately Rs.657.
 
Saharanpur
Check out all the available routes from Saharanpur to Shivpuri →

Other popular routes from Shivpuri